2. Dividend Yield
The dividend yield is a financial ratio that reveals the return on investment an investor receives solely from dividends relative to the stock’s price. For those holding positions in the shares of a particular renewable energy provider, it signifies the annual dividend income as a percentage of the stock’s current market value.
- Calculation and Interpretation
The dividend yield is calculated by dividing the annual dividend per share by the current market price per share. A higher yield indicates that the investor is receiving a larger dividend income relative to the stock price. This can be attractive to income-seeking investors; however, it is important to consider the sustainability of the dividend. For the specified renewable energy enterprise, the dividend yield may be influenced by factors such as profitability, cash flow, and capital expenditure requirements for new projects. A consistently high yield may indicate financial stability, while a fluctuating yield could suggest uncertainty in the company’s earnings.
- Comparative Analysis
The ratio enables comparisons with other companies in the renewable energy sector and across different industries. It allows investors to assess the relative attractiveness of one equity versus another based on dividend income. A lower yield compared to its peers may indicate that the market perceives stronger growth prospects or lower risk, while a significantly higher yield may suggest that the market has concerns about the sustainability of the dividend payout. Investors should consider these comparisons within the context of the company’s overall financial health and growth potential.
- Impact of Stock Price Volatility
The dividend yield is inversely related to the stock price. If the stock price decreases, the dividend yield increases, assuming the annual dividend remains constant. Conversely, if the stock price increases, the yield decreases. This relationship highlights the impact of market fluctuations on the attractiveness of the dividend income. Significant price volatility can lead to fluctuations in the dividend yield, potentially influencing investor sentiment and trading activity.
- Sustainability and Growth
A sustainable ratio depends on the company’s ability to generate sufficient cash flow to cover dividend payments. A dividend payout ratio that is consistently high may signal that the company is distributing a large portion of its earnings as dividends, leaving less capital for reinvestment and growth. Conversely, a lower payout ratio may indicate greater financial flexibility and potential for future dividend increases. The specific renewable energy enterprise must balance dividend payments with the need to invest in new projects and maintain financial stability.

Earnings per share (EPS) is a critical financial metric directly impacting valuation assessment for publicly traded entities. For a firm in the renewable energy sector, EPS provides an indicator of profitability allocated to each outstanding share, thereby influencing investor perceptions and stock performance.
- Calculation and Interpretation
EPS is computed by dividing a company’s net income by the weighted average number of outstanding shares. A higher EPS generally suggests greater profitability and increased value accruing to shareholders. In the context of the subject renewable energy corporation, a rising EPS may reflect the successful operation of its renewable energy projects, efficient cost management, or favorable market conditions for renewable energy generation. Conversely, a declining EPS could signal operational challenges, increased competition, or adverse changes in regulatory policies affecting the renewable energy sector.
- Impact on Valuation Ratios
EPS is a key input in various valuation ratios, most notably the price-to-earnings (P/E) ratio. The P/E ratio, calculated by dividing the stock price by the EPS, provides insights into how much investors are willing to pay for each dollar of earnings. A high P/E ratio may indicate that investors have high expectations for future earnings growth. For the specified energy firm, a P/E ratio significantly above or below the industry average warrants further investigation to determine whether the stock is overvalued or undervalued. Factors such as growth prospects, risk profile, and competitive positioning must be considered.
- Influence on Investor Sentiment
EPS announcements often have a direct and immediate effect on investor sentiment and stock price movement. Positive EPS surprises, where the actual EPS exceeds analysts’ expectations, can lead to increased buying pressure and a rise in the stock price. Conversely, negative EPS surprises can trigger selling pressure and a decline in the stock price. Therefore, the firm’s ability to consistently meet or exceed EPS expectations is crucial for maintaining investor confidence and supporting the stock’s valuation.
- Relevance to Dividend Policy
While not directly determinative, EPS significantly informs a company’s dividend policy. A consistently strong EPS provides the financial basis for the company to distribute dividends to shareholders. A high and sustainable EPS typically enables the payment of consistent or increasing dividends, which can enhance the attractiveness of the stock to income-seeking investors. If the renewable energy firm’s EPS is insufficient to support its dividend payments, it may need to reduce its dividend payout, potentially negatively impacting investor perception and stock performance.

4. Renewable Portfolio
A company’s renewable portfolio defines its collection of assets and projects dedicated to generating energy from renewable sources. This portfolio is fundamentally linked to the equity valuation of companies, as the performance and potential of these assets directly influence financial metrics and investor sentiment.
- Energy Source Diversification
The diversity within the portfolio affects financial risk and stability. A portfolio heavily reliant on a single energy source, such as wind, exposes the entity to geographical weather patterns and technological obsolescence. In contrast, a portfolio encompassing wind, solar, hydro, and potentially emerging technologies spreads risk. This diversification, or lack thereof, has a demonstrable impact on investor perception of long-term value and is reflected in the valuation. For instance, an unforeseen drought could dramatically reduce the output of a hydro-dependent portfolio, affecting revenue and investor confidence.
- Geographic Distribution
Geographic distribution impacts the regulatory burden. Concentrating projects in a small region heightens risk associated with local permitting delays, changing governmental incentives, or specific regional economic downturns. Dispersing projects across multiple political or geographical regions reduces this risk. A negative regulatory change in one region is less consequential for a firm with broad dispersion.
- Technological Efficiency
The technological efficiency and maturity of the renewable projects directly impacts profitability and investor confidence. Older, less efficient technologies have lower revenue potential and higher operating costs. Implementing newer, more efficient technologies enhances electricity generation, reduces operational costs, and signals an investment in long-term competitiveness. Deployment of advanced materials, improved turbine designs, or smart grid integration can increase returns and signal corporate commitment to technology leadership, thereby improving its rating.
- Contractual Arrangements
Contractual arrangements of the company’s power output significantly influences revenue stability and predictability. Projects operating under long-term power purchase agreements (PPAs) with creditworthy counterparties provide stable revenue streams and reduce exposure to short-term wholesale market volatility. Conversely, projects relying on merchant power sales are subject to fluctuations in energy prices, which could impact revenue and shareholder earnings. The terms and stability of these PPAs are therefore central to assessing risks involved with equities within this company and others like it.

5. Debt-to-equity ratio
The debt-to-equity ratio provides insights into the capital structure of a company, specifically the proportion of debt financing relative to equity financing. For a corporation involved in renewable energy, such as Innergex, this ratio is a critical indicator of financial leverage and associated risk. A high ratio suggests the company relies heavily on debt to fund its operations and expansion, which can amplify both potential returns and financial vulnerability. For example, a renewable energy company undertaking large-scale infrastructure projects, such as wind farms or hydroelectric facilities, may initially exhibit a high debt-to-equity ratio due to the substantial capital expenditure required. However, if the projects generate stable and predictable revenue streams, the debt can be effectively managed. Conversely, a low ratio indicates a more conservative financial approach, potentially limiting growth but also reducing the risk of financial distress during economic downturns.
The importance of understanding this ratio stems from its direct influence on investor perception and the cost of capital. A high debt-to-equity ratio can raise concerns among investors about the company’s ability to meet its debt obligations, potentially leading to a lower stock valuation. Lenders may also demand higher interest rates to compensate for the increased risk. For Innergex, maintaining a balanced debt-to-equity ratio is crucial for attracting investment and securing favorable financing terms for future projects. Analyzing historical trends in the company’s ratio, compared against industry benchmarks, allows for a more nuanced assessment of its financial stability. For instance, comparing Innergex’s ratio to that of its competitors reveals whether it is more or less financially leveraged relative to other players in the renewable energy sector.
